ovicide
ovi·cide
noun \ˈō-və-ˌsīd\Definition of OVICIDE
: an agent that kills eggs; especially : an insecticide effective against the egg stage
— ovi·cid·al \ˌō-və-ˈsī-dəl\ adjective
Origin of OVICIDE
International Scientific Vocabulary
First Known Use: 1913
